So far my largest issue remains the apparent inability to absorb the last De Jure duchy of a Kingdom, which seems to be the case whether created or not de facto. I wonder if this is WAD?

On a separate note, it appears when you have multiple kingdoms there is no drift. Rus and Poland are jointly ruled by a Russian and they are not merging. So this system is extremely unlikely to ever allow the unification of Spain for instance.
 
So far my largest issue remains the apparent inability to absorb the last De Jure duchy of a Kingdom, which seems to be the case whether created or not de facto. I wonder if this is WAD?

On a separate note, it appears when you have multiple kingdoms there is no drift. Rus and Poland are jointly ruled by a Russian and they are not merging.

There is no rule preventing the last duchy from assimilating. However, duchies in the same de facto state will not assimilate, no. That is WAD.
